Corvid Technologies is seeking an Junior HPC Systems Engineer with a strong background and enthusiasm for Linux to support our Linux based High Performance Computer consisting of 80,000+ processor cores. If you enjoy learning, playing with hardware, optimizing performance, efficiency, and spend most of your time on the command line, this is the job for you.

This candidate will be responsible for the following:

  • Supporting software installation and configuration of license management servers (e.g., FlexLM or RLM)
  • Troubleshoot slow, hanging, or failing HPC jobs on internal or customer HPC clusters
  • Automate repetitive tasks and implement custom solutions using scripting/programming languages such as bash or Python
  • Learning to troubleshoot hardware and software issues on Linux servers, and how to install, configure, and design HPC systems
  • Design, test and implement an HPC environment consisting of a provisioner (Warewulf), scheduler (Slurm), RDMA connections (e.g
  • InfiniBand), a subnet manager, head node, storage node, and 5+ compute nodes within the first 180 days of employment
  • Obtaining a CompTIA Security+ certification within the first year of employment

Founded in 2004, we are a group of over 300 engineers and scientists, about 3/4 with master’ degrees or Ph.D.'s, that provide end-to-end solutions including concept development, design and optimization, prototype build, test and manufacture. We leverage the predictive capability of our high-fidelity computational physics solvers, indigenous massively parallel supercomputer system, prototyping plant, and ballistics and mechanics lab to investigate a variety of high-rate physics phenomena.

The results are complex engineering solutions for a variety of applications; aircraft, ballistic missile defense, cybersecurity, motorsports, armor development, biological systems, and missile and warhead design and development. These results are achieved with optimal design and cost efficiency due to the predictive capability of Corvid’s tools and our in-house, end-to-end integrated approach, which differentiates Corvid from the market.
